Sound Healing – 60 minutes
Immersive nervous system reset
A full-body immersive sound session using a combination of instruments, including singing bowls, tuning forks, ocean drum, Koshi chimes, and other grounding sound tools.
You remain fully clothed and lie comfortably supported.
The instruments are used intuitively and intentionally, depending on what your nervous system responds to in the moment.
Vibration works directly with the body. Rhythm supports regulation. Tone creates space.
This work can help release physical holding patterns and accumulated tension.
It can quiet mental noise and create space from constant thinking.
It can deepen breathing and restore a sense of steadiness in the body.
It can reconnect you to yourself during demanding or transitional periods.
Sessions are receptive. You are guided into rest while the sound does its work.

Chakra Balancing Sound Massage – 60 Minutes
Focused vibrational alignment
A slower, more focused session with bowls placed directly on specific areas of the body connected to energetic centers.
This work supports alignment, emotional processing, and deeper internal reset.
You remain fully clothed and lie comfortably supported.
This session can help restore a sense of internal alignment when you feel scattered or out of sync.
It can soften emotional heaviness that feels undefined or difficult to articulate.
It can create a slower, more focused reset when your system needs re-centering rather than deep immersion.
It can support steadiness during periods of transition or energetic depletion.
You do not need to “believe in chakras” for the session to be effective.
The body responds to vibration regardless of language.

Frequently Asked Questions
Do I need to believe in spirituality for this work?
No. The work is grounded in nervous system regulation and intentional space-holding. Spiritual language is optional.
What if I don’t feel anything during a session?
That is completely valid. The body processes in its own time.
Can I attend a grief circle without speaking?
Yes. Participation is always by choice.
Is cacao mandatory?
No. It is optional and never required.
Is this therapy?
No. This work supports emotional and nervous system regulation but does not replace medical or psychological care.
How often should I come?
Some people book occasionally during intense periods. Others return seasonally or monthly.

Sound sessions are generally safe for most people. However, please consult with me beforehand if you:
• have a pacemaker or implanted medical device
• are in the first trimester of pregnancy
• have epilepsy or a seizure disorder
• experience sound-induced migraines
• are in an acute psychiatric crisis
If you are unsure, reach out. We can decide together whether this is appropriate for you.
